Medicare Principles Explained

Original Medicare is provided by the US government to folks who are over age 65 or under 65 and on disability. Medicare is made up of Parts A and B. Part A covers hospital insurance and Part B covers doctor visits and outpatient services. Generally, Medicare covers 80 percent of the invoice so there is 20% left combined with various deductibles copays and coinsurances. Due to these openings left over many folks decide to acquire a Medicare Supplement Plan to pay what Medicare does not fully cover, these plans are also referred to as Medigap plans.

Medigap Basics

The hottest Medicare supplement plans are programs F, G, & N. Because the plans are standardized and the benefits are governed by the US government there’s no gap in policy between companies for the specific same plan. In any particular state from the U.S. there are approximately 30 or more carriers offering these plans, each in a different cost.

With almost any standardized Medigap insurance plan you can visit any doctor anywhere in the nation that accepts Medicare, no referrals needed. Additionally plans F, G and N have a restricted foreign travel benefit that’s useful for all those folks May travel outside of the country.

Additionally, it’s important to note that prescription coverage isn’t provided on any standardized Medicare Supplement Plan, it’s covered under another program known as part D.

These plans are also guaranteed-renewable for lifetime, premiums can’t be increased as a result of health or canceled due to health.

Medigap Plan F

Medicare Supplement Plan F is most comprehensive of Medicare supplement plans and the priciest. Coverage is pretty straightforward, this program covers everything Medicare does not fully pay, like the 20 percent and most of deductibles copays and coinsurances. With a Plan F, you should never have a medical bill, as long as the services you receive are accepted by Medicare.

Supplemental Plan G

Medicare supplement program G has become the most popular plan option in 2021. Plan G is thought to be the most cost-effective plan compared to with another Medicare supplement plans available. This plan option is very similar to Plan F, it insures 100% of everything except for the part B deductible that is not insured and that deductible is $203 in 2021.

The reason plan G is thought to be the most cost-effective plan is because compared against Plan F, the amount of money that you save in premium is greater than the difference, which can be (amount) in (year). Additionally, the rate increases on average, historically are somewhat less on Plan G compared to Plan F. Additionally, Plan F isn’t likely to be provided following 2022 to individuals turning 65 which will most likely cause the prices to go up over they’ve gone up in the past. Another reason Plan G a far better long-term option.

Medigap Plan N

Medicare Supplement Plan N is the most affordable of the three . Plan N is similar to insurance plan G, except the following out-of-pocket expenses on insurance N:

$0-$20 office visit copay
$50 at the emergency room (waived if admitted)
Part B excess charges aren’t covered

Plan N is a potential great match for someone who does not find the physician on a regular basis, this individual would not incur the office visit copay every time they see the doctor. If you are wanting to save some premium dollars insurance plan N can be a good fit for you.
